In a recent discussion, the Oscar-winning actor delved into his love for making sports-themed movies, highlighting his experiences with hits like "F1" and "Moneyball." Pitt emphasized the unique storytelling opportunities that sports films provide, allowing for a blend of personal struggle, triumph, and the human spirit's resilience. He believes that these narratives resonate deeply with audiences, as they often reflect real-life challenges and victories.
Pitt also shared valuable advice for aspiring actors, encouraging them to embrace authenticity in their performances. He stressed the importance of connecting with the material and understanding the underlying emotions of the characters they portray. According to him, the key to success in acting lies in the ability to convey genuine feelings, which is especially crucial in sports films where stakes are high and emotions run deep.
As he continues to explore diverse roles and projects, Pitt's passion for sports cinema remains evident, inspiring both fans and future generations of actors.
